Python Programlama Dilini Öğrenme Yöntemleri Yolları (Detaylı Eğitim Dokümanı)
- 1. Python programlama dili nerelerde kullanılır?
- 2. Python programlama dili ile ne gibi projeler yapabilirim?
- 3. Python programlama dili yapılmış örnek programlar veya web siteler yada uygulamalar nelerdir?
- 4. Python programlama dilini nasıl öğrenirim? ve 5. Python eğitimi konu başlıkları listeleri
Python Eğitim- Akblog Net |
1. Python programlama dili nerelerde kullanılır?
Python, web uygulamaları geliştirmek için yaygın olarak kullanılan bir dildir. Django, Flask ve Pyramid gibi Python web çerçeveleri, web geliştirme sürecini kolaylaştırır.
Python, veri bilimi için popüler bir dildir. NumPy, Pandas ve SciPy gibi Python kütüphaneleri, büyük miktarda verinin toplanması, analiz edilmesi ve görselleştirilmesi için kullanılabilir.
Python, makine öğrenimi için de popüler bir dildir. TensorFlow, PyTorch ve scikit-learn gibi Python kütüphaneleri, makine öğrenimi modellerinin geliştirilmesi ve eğitilmesi için kullanılabilir.
Python, otomasyon için de yaygın olarak kullanılan bir dildir. Selenium ve PyAutoGUI gibi Python kütüphaneleri, web sitelerinin ve masaüstü uygulamalarının otomatikleştirilmesi için kullanılabilir.
Python, grafik tasarım için de kullanılabilir. Matplotlib ve Seaborn gibi Python kütüphaneleri, veri görselleştirme için kullanılabilir.
2. Python programlama dili ile ne gibi projeler yapabilirim?
İşte Python programlama dili ile yapabileceğiniz bazı proje fikirleri:
Bir web sitesi oluşturun.Bir veri analizi projesi yapın.Bir makine öğrenimi modeli geliştirin.Bir otomasyon görevi oluşturun.Bir grafik tasarım uygulaması oluşturun.
3. Python programlama dili yapılmış örnek programlar veya web siteler yada uygulamalar nelerdir?
Aşağıda sizlere Python üzerinden yapılmış uygulamaları listeledik.
Instagram, Reddit, Spotify, Netflix, YouTube gibi popüler web siteleri Python ile geliştirilmiştir.
Google Chrome, Firefox, VLC Media Player, Spotify gibi popüler uygulamalar Python ile geliştirilmiştir.
Selenium, PyAutoGUI gibi Python kütüphaneleri, web sitelerinin ve masaüstü uygulamalarının otomatikleştirilmesi için kullanılır.
NumPy, Pandas, SciPy gibi Python kütüphaneleri, büyük miktarda verinin toplanması, analiz edilmesi ve görselleştirilmesi için kullanılır.
TensorFlow, PyTorch, scikit-learn gibi Python kütüphaneleri, makine öğrenimi modellerinin geliştirilmesi ve eğitilmesi için kullanılır.
4. Python programlama dilini nasıl öğrenirim?
4.1 Python programlama dilini öğrenmek için birçok farklı yol vardır. İşte bunlardan bazıları:
Python programlama dili hakkında kurslar almak, öğrenmenin en iyi yollarından biridir. İnternette ve üniversitelerde Python programlama dili hakkında birçok farklı kurs bulabilirsiniz.
Python programlama dili hakkında kitaplar okumak da öğrenmenin iyi bir yoludur. Python programlama dili hakkında birçok farklı kitap piyasada mevcuttur.
Python programlama dili hakkında birçok farklı online kaynak bulabilirsiniz. YouTube'da Python programlama dili hakkında birçok video bulabilirsiniz. Ayrıca, Python programlama dili hakkında birçok blog ve web sitesi de mevcuttur.
4.2 Python programlama dilini öğrenmeye yeni başlayanlar için aşağıdaki adımları takip etmenizi tavsiye ederim:
Python'un temellerini öğrenmek için bir kurs veya kitaptan yardım alabilirsiniz. Temel bilgiler arasında değişkenler, veri türleri, ifadeler, döngüler, fonksiyonlar ve modüller bulunur.
Öğrendiklerinizi pekiştirmek için örnek projeler yapın. Bu, Python'un farklı yönlerini uygulamanıza ve pratik yapmanıza yardımcı olacaktır.
Python programlama dili hakkında bilgi edinmek için başkalarıyla sosyalleşin. Python programlama dili topluluklarında aktif olmak, öğrenmenize ve yeni şeyler keşfetmenize yardımcı olacaktır.
4.3 Python eğitim videoları önerilerinde (Ücretsiz Kaynaklar) bulunabilir misin? Derseniz cevabımız aşağıdaki gibi olacaktır.
Bu video serisi, Python'un temellerini öğreten kapsamlı ve anlaşılır bir kaynaktır.
Bu video serisi, Python'u öğrenebileceğiniz eğlenceli ve zorlu bir yoldur.
Bu video serisi, Python'u adım adım öğreten hızlı ve etkili bir kaynaktır.
Bu kurs, Python'un veri bilimi için nasıl kullanılacağını öğreten kapsamlı bir kaynaktır.
Bu kurs, Python'un makine öğrenimi için nasıl kullanılacağını öğreten kapsamlı bir kaynaktır.
4.4. İşte bu video serilerinden bazılarının kısa bir özeti:
Bu video serisi, Python'un temellerini öğreten kapsamlı ve anlaşılır bir kaynaktır. Videolar, değişkenler, veri türleri, ifadeler, döngüler, fonksiyonlar ve modüller gibi temel kavramları kapsar.
Bu video serisi, Python'u öğrenebileceğiniz eğlenceli ve zorlu bir yoldur. Videolar, Python'un temellerini öğretirken, kodlama becerilerinizi geliştirmenize yardımcı olmak için çeşitli zorluklar ve egzersizler sunar.
Bu video serisi, Python'u adım adım öğreten hızlı ve etkili bir kaynaktır. Videolar, Python'un temellerini öğretirken, kodlama becerilerinizi geliştirmenize yardımcı olmak için çeşitli kısa videolar sunar.
Bu kurs, Python'un veri bilimi için nasıl kullanılacağını öğreten kapsamlı bir kaynaktır. Kurs, NumPy, Pandas ve Matplotlib gibi veri bilimi için yaygın olarak kullanılan Python kütüphanelerini kapsar.
Bu kurs, Python'un makine öğrenimi için nasıl kullanılacağını öğreten kapsamlı bir kaynaktır. Kurs, TensorFlow ve scikit-learn gibi makine öğrenimi için yaygın olarak kullanılan Python kütüphanelerini kapsar.
Türkçe python doküman kaynak paylaşımı yapalım.
Python'un resmi belgeleri, Python'un tüm özelliklerini ve işlevlerini kapsayan kapsamlı bir kaynaktır. Türkçe çevirisi de mevcuttur.
Python dersleri, Python'un temellerini öğreten çeşitli kaynaklardır. Türkçe olarak yayınlanan birçok Python ders kitabı ve videosu bulunmaktadır.
Python, çok çeşitli kütüphaneler sunar. Bu kütüphanelerin belgeleri, kütüphanelerin nasıl kullanılacağını öğrenmek için faydalı bir kaynaktır. Türkçe olarak yayınlanan birçok Python kütüphanesi belgesi bulunmaktadır.
Python belgeleri, Python'un resmi belgeleridir. Python'un tüm özelliklerini ve işlevlerini kapsayan kapsamlı bir kaynaktır. Türkçe çevirisi de mevcuttur.
Python dersleri, Python'un temellerini öğreten çeşitli kaynaklardır. Türkçe olarak yayınlanan birçok Python ders kitabı ve videosu bulunmaktadır.
Python, çok çeşitli kütüphaneler sunar. Bu kütüphanelerin belgeleri, kütüphanelerin nasıl kullanılacağını öğrenmek için faydalı bir kaynaktır. Türkçe olarak yayınlanan birçok Python kütüphanesi belgesi bulunmaktadır.
- Yeni Başlayanlar İçin Python - Ahmet Alpat
- Python - Mustafa Başer
- Python Eğitim Kitabı - Volkan TAŞCI
- Python Kütüphaneleri
- NumPy - Metehan Özbek
- Pandas - Mert Mekatronik
- Matplotlib - İlker Manap
5. Python eğitimi konu başlıkları listeler
5.1 Temel konular:
Python'a girişDeğişkenler ve veri türleriOperatörlerİfadelerDöngülerFonksiyonlarModüllerİleri seviye konular:
5.2 Python temel konuları
Python temel konuları, Python programlama dilinin temellerini kapsamaktadır. Bu konular, Python programlama dilini öğrenmeye yeni başlayanlar için önemlidir.
Python'a giriş
Python'a giriş, Python programlama dilinin temellerini kapsayan bir konudur. Bu konuda, Python'un amacı, tarihi, özellikleri ve kurulumu gibi konular ele alınır.
Değişkenler ve veri türleri
Değişkenler ve veri türleri, Python programlama dilinde veri depolamak ve işlemek için kullanılan araçlardır. Bu konuda, değişkenler, veri türleri ve veri türleri arasında dönüşüm gibi konular ele alınır.
Operatörler
Operatörler, Python programlama dilinde matematiksel, mantıksal ve karşılaştırma işlemleri yapmak için kullanılır. Bu konuda, aritmetik, mantıksal ve karşılaştırma operatörleri gibi konular ele alınır.
İfadeler
İfadeler, Python programlama dilinde değerleri veya sonuçları temsil eden yapılardır. Bu konuda, değişkenler, operatörler ve işlevler kullanarak ifadeler oluşturma gibi konular ele alınır.
Döngüler
Döngüler, Python programlama dilinde belirli bir işlemi tekrarlı olarak yapmak için kullanılır. Bu konuda, for döngüleri, while döngüleri ve break ve continue ifadeleri gibi konular ele alınır.
Fonksiyonlar
Fonksiyonlar, Python programlama dilinde belirli bir görevi yerine getirmek için kullanılan yapılardır. Bu konuda, fonksiyonların tanımı, kullanımı ve parametreleri gibi konular ele alınır.
Fonksiyonlar konu başlığı
Modüller
Modüller, Python programlama dilinde belirli bir işlevi veya görevi yerine getiren kod parçalarıdır. Bu konuda, modüllerin tanımı, kullanımı ve import ve from import ifadeleri gibi konular ele alınır.
Python temel konuları, Python programlama dilinin temellerini öğrenmek için önemlidir. Bu konuları öğrendikten sonra, Python programlama dilinin daha ileri düzey özelliklerini öğrenmeye başlayabilirsiniz.
5.3 Veri yapıları
Obje yönelimli programlamaDosya işlemleriİnternet programlamaVeri bilimiMakine öğrenimi
5.4 Python veri yapıları,
Python veri yapıları, Python programlama dilinde verilerin depolanması ve işlenmesi için kullanılan yapılardır. Veri yapıları, programın performansını ve verimliliğini artırmaya yardımcı olur.
5.4.1 Python'da kullanılan başlıca veri yapıları şunlardır:
Listeler:
Listeler, Python'da en yaygın kullanılan veri yapılarından biridir. Listeler, birbiri ardına yerleştirilmiş veri öğelerinden oluşan bir koleksiyondur. Listeler, sıralı veya sırasız olabilir.
Diziler:
Diziler, Python'da başka bir yaygın veri yapısıdır. Diziler, aynı veri türünden öğelerden oluşan bir koleksiyondur. Diziler, sıralı veya sırasız olabilir.
Tuple'lar:
Tuple'lar, değiştirilemeyen öğelerden oluşan bir koleksiyondur. Tuple'lar, listelere benzer, ancak değiştirilemezler. Tuple'lar, sıralı veya sırasız olabilir.
Sözlükler:
Sözlükler, anahtar-değer çiftlerinden oluşan bir koleksiyondur. Sözlükler, anahtarlara göre öğelere erişmeyi kolaylaştırır.
Set'ler:
Set'ler, benzersiz öğelerden oluşan bir koleksiyondur. Set'ler, öğeleri sıraya koymaz.
Veri yapılarının her birinin kendi avantajları ve dezavantajları vardır. Hangi veri yapısının kullanılacağı, uygulamanın gereksinimlerine bağlıdır.
İşte veri yapılarının bazı kullanım örnekleri:
Listeler, bir dizi öğeyi depolamak için kullanılabilir. Örneğin, bir alışveriş listesi oluşturmak için bir liste kullanılabilir.
Diziler, aynı türden öğeleri depolamak için kullanılabilir. Örneğin, bir dizi sayıyı depolamak için bir dizi kullanılabilir.
Tuple'lar, değiştirilemeyen öğeleri depolamak için kullanılabilir. Örneğin, bir kullanıcının kimlik bilgilerini depolamak için bir tuple kullanılabilir.
Sözlükler, anahtar-değer çiftlerini depolamak için kullanılabilir. Örneğin, bir kişinin adının ve soyadının bir eşleştirilmesini depolamak için bir sözlük kullanılabilir.
Set'ler, benzersiz öğeleri depolamak için kullanılabilir. Örneğin, bir dizi benzersiz sayıyı depolamak için bir set kullanılabilir.
Python veri yapıları, Python programlama dilinin güçlü bir özelliğidir. Veri yapılarını kullanarak, programlarınızın performansını ve verimliliğini artırabilirsiniz.
5.3 Örnek projeler:
Bir web sitesi oluşturun.Bir veri analizi projesi yapın.Bir makine öğrenimi modeli geliştirin.Bir otomasyon görevi oluşturun.Bir grafik tasarım uygulaması oluşturun.
Kaynak: Akblog.NET
Yorum yapın yav. :))) o kadar yazdık.
YanıtlaSilSadece mükkemel. :)))
YanıtlaSilBeynim yandı.
YanıtlaSil